Product Overview & Specifications

The Seork backflow repair kit targets the most common wear components in Wilkins 975XL and Zurn 975XL2 reduced pressure principle backflow preventers. These assemblies protect drinking water from contamination, and when they start leaking—which they inevitably do after 2-5 years—you’re facing a repair that typically costs $150-$300 if hired out.

What makes this kit practical is that it includes exactly what fails most frequently: the diaphragm, check seats, O-rings, spring, and plungers. In my experience, 80% of backflow preventer issues trace back to these components becoming stiff, cracked, or corroded.

Real-World Performance & Feature Analysis

Design & Build Quality

Opening the Seork backflow repair kit, the first thing I noticed was the organized presentation. Each component sits in its own compartment, which matters more than you might think—O-rings can develop flat spots if compressed during shipping, and diaphragms can crease.

The metals show even machining with no visible burrs. When inspecting the spring—arguably the most critical component for maintaining proper pressure differential—I found the coil spacing consistent and the ends cleanly cut. However, when compared side-by-side with a genuine Wilkins spring, the Seork version has slightly less resistance. Not dramatically different, but noticeable if you’re handling both.

The rubber components feel pliable but not soft. The diaphragm has good thickness and flexibility, while the O-rings maintain their round cross-section without flattening. After installing these in everything from residential irrigation systems to commercial building supply lines, I’ve found the material quality consistently adequate for the price point.

Performance in Real Use

I installed my first Seork backflow repair kit on a Wilkins 975XL that was dripping continuously from the relief port—a classic symptom of worn check seats or diaphragm. The repair stopped the leakage immediately, and that particular unit has been operating without issues for over 14 months now.

However, not all installations go perfectly. On one Zurn 975XL2 with significant mineral buildup in the body, the Seork check seats didn’t seal quite as effectively as OEM parts would have. The fix required additional cleaning of the seat surfaces in the preventer body—something that might not have been necessary with genuine parts that have slightly more precise dimensions.

Where this kit excels: Standard residential applications, irrigation systems, and situations where the backflow preventer body is in good condition. The components create reliable seals and withstand normal pressure fluctuations without problems.

Where it struggles: Heavily scaled or pitted preventer bodies, applications with frequent pressure surges, and installations requiring certified components for compliance documentation.

Ease of Use

If you’ve never rebuilt a backflow preventer before, the Seork backflow repair kit won’t magically make the process beginner-friendly. These assemblies contain precision components that must be installed in correct sequence and orientation.

That said, having all necessary components in one kit eliminates the frustration of discovering mid-repair that you’re missing an O-ring or seal. The included retaining bolt matches the original specification, and the plungers drop into place without modification.

The most common installation mistake I see is over-tightening the relief valve cover—this can distort the new diaphragm and cause premature failure. The Seork diaphragm seems slightly more forgiving in this regard than some budget alternatives, but it’s still something to be mindful of.

Durability & Reliability

After monitoring several installations in different environments, I’ve found the Seork backflow repair kit typically provides 2-3 years of reliable service in residential applications. This matches the lower end of what I’d expect from OEM parts, which often last 3-5 years.

The rubber components show minimal degradation after 18 months in service—no cracking or hardening that sometimes plagues cheap alternatives. The metal components maintain their corrosion resistance even in areas with aggressive water chemistry.

One limitation worth noting: these kits don’t include the relief valve itself or the body O-rings. If your backflow preventer has more extensive issues, you might need additional parts beyond what this kit provides.

Comparison & Alternatives

Understanding where the Seork backflow repair kit fits in the market helps determine if it’s right for your situation.

Cheaper Alternative: Generic eBay/Amazon Kits ($12-15)

These ultra-budget kits typically come in unmarked plastic bags with questionable material quality. I’ve tested several and found inconsistent rubber compound hardness, poorly machined metal components, and springs that lose tension quickly. The Seork kit is worth the extra $6-8 for significantly better materials and reliability.

Premium Alternative: Genuine Wilkins/Zurn OEM Kit ($40-55)

OEM kits offer perfect compatibility, certified specifications, and typically include additional components like body O-rings. The material quality is superior, with more precise machining and rubber formulated for longer service life. Choose OEM if: You need certified components for compliance, your preventer body shows wear, or you want maximum longevity.

The Seork kit occupies the sweet spot between these options—better quality than bargain-basement alternatives without the premium price of genuine parts.

FAQ

Does this kit work with both Wilkins 975XL and Zurn 975XL2 models?
Yes, the components are interchangeable between these models. The Zurn 975XL2 is essentially the same assembly after Zurn acquired Wilkins.

How long does installation typically take?
For someone familiar with backflow preventers, about 20-30 minutes. First-timers should budget 1-2 hours, including research time.

Will this fix a continuously dripping relief port?
In most cases, yes—this is exactly what these kits are designed to address. The combination of new check seats, diaphragm, and spring typically resolves leakage issues.

Is the Seork kit worth buying over OEM parts?
For budget-conscious repairs where certification isn’t required, absolutely. The cost savings are substantial, and the performance is adequate for most applications. When compliance or maximum longevity are priorities, spend the extra for genuine parts.

What tools are needed for installation?
Basic screwdrivers, adjustable wrenches, and possibly a socket set. Having a backpressure wrench makes the job easier but isn’t essential.
